MU-4
I2T2
Mixed-Use High Density District
The purpose and intent of the board of commissioners in establishing all districts designated as Mixed-Use MU-4 Zoning Districts are as follows: To encourage the development of master or comprehensively planned, mixed-use developments; To permit flexible and compatible arrangements of residential, commercial, office, institutional, and civic uses; To offer a variety of housing options, including multi-family residential and single-family attached housing of various densities, upper-floor residential units over non-residential space, or active adult and/or senior housing; To implement the future development map of the county's most current comprehensive plan; To maintain harmony of scale, intensity, and design of character areas with varying housing options; To accommodate and promote mixed-use buildings with amenities and services provided by a variety of non-residential uses, as appropriate in the activity centers established by the comprehensive plan; To promote the health and well-being of residents through the development of living environments that accommodate pedestrians and bicyclists; To encourage a sense of community through design that promotes social interaction; and To reduce automobile traffic and congestion and promote the use of transit by encouraging appropriate development densities.
